Summer Day Camp - Marquette, NE
Is your child excited about camp but not quite ready to spend the night? Good news! Timberlake offers Day Camp every Wednesday of regular camp for children from Kindergarten to 5th Grade. Each Day Camp offers a rotation of different typical camp activities. We provide lunch for every camper, and they are put into small "cabin" groups, always in the care of our trained staff. NOTE: Preregistration for Day Camp is not necessary. If you wish, you can simply register and pay when you arrive at camp. Schedule 8:40-9 am - Check in (Follow the signs!) 9:30-11:30 - Rotation of games, camp activities 11:30-12:30 - Lunch and change for swimming 12:30-3:00 - Boats, swim time and camp store 3:00-3:30 - Bible Time with the camp pastor 4 pm - Pick up time What to Bring Wear clothes that can get dirty and muddy. Swimsuit, towel, and sunscreen for the lake. Water bottle. Optional: Snack money for the camp store (lunch is provided).

3B. Summer Camp - Build Your Own Computer-4 Days - Gizmos & Gadgets Kids Lab
In this hands-on investigation, kids will learn how a computer works by building a simple Raspberry Pi computer. Once the building is done, the fun continues while kids create their own versions of simple games and code in Minecraft on the computer they just built. We will have plenty of time off the computer as well when kids have the chance to learn and test game design and programming through active play. Kids keep their Raspberry Pi mini computer, WiPi, keyboard and all cables, as well as all their projects that they have compiled during the week! (858)964-0645
